Volodymyr Zelensky: Latest News and Updates

Volodymyr Zelensky is the President of Ukraine. He was elected in 2019 after running on an anti-corruption platform, transitioning from a political outsider to a global figure. His leadership during the 2022 Russian invasion of Ukraine has been widely recognised, demonstrating exceptional resolve in rallying his nation and mobilising international support.
